Upcoming Mahindra Scorpio Pik Up Spied With Subtle Interior Updates
The clearest spy shots yet of the 2026 Mahindra Scorpio Pik Up show a luxury interior and rugged design. 2026 launch incoming!

Mahindra is gearing up for the ultimate launch of its much-anticipated models, such as the 2026 Scorpio N, the Thar facelift, and the popular Scorpio Pik Up truck. This upcoming Pik Up truck will be based on the Scorpio N SUV that was caught being spied on while testing on the road recently. A recent spy shot is surfacing on the internet showing some subtle interior tweaks inside the new cabin of the upcoming pickup truck.
These latest images, surfacing just weeks ago, show a double-cab prototype undergoing rigorous testing in India. The truck drew its inspiration from the Mahindra Global Pik Up Vision Concept that was displayed for the first time at the Mahindra Vision Show in 2025. The latest iteration was spotted with huge camouflage, giving us a hint at what to expect from the pickup truck.
Exterior Design Highlights

This will be the second time that the Mahindra Scorpio Pik Up truck has been spotted testing. The test mule shows a double-cab 4-door model, and another single-cab 2-door model is also being tested in parallel. The front fascia of the pickup truck comes with retro LED headlights, which are still not finalized, and the same is the case with the rear lights too.
Temporary LED headlights and taillights borrowed from older models suggest production units are still refining their look, but the upright bonnet, chunky ORVMs, and shark-fin antenna scream Scorpio family DNA. Even the tyres look fine, offering 18 inches, which is decent for off-roading and a muscular look.
New Interiors Revealed

Peeking inside these latest shots is where things get exciting. The interior elements might be the same as those shared with the upcoming Scorpio N facelift. The dashboard might be equipped with a larger freestanding infotainment screen, paired with a fully digital instrument cluster that ditches analog dials for a vibrant multi-info display. This time, the brand will make a bold move by providing a single-pane sunroof. Additional features might be as follows:
- Dual-Zone Climate Control
- Electronic Parking Brake
- Front Ventilated Seats
- Wireless Charging
- Touchscreen infotainment system
- 4 Airbags
- ABS
The cabin sports a brown-black dual-tone theme, a roomier rear bench than the Hilux, and a front center armrest straight from the Scorpio-N.
Mahindra Scorpio Pik Up: Powertrain Speculations
Under the hood, we can expect the Gen-2 mHawk diesel from the concept model. This engine will be paired with a 6-speed automatic, as seen on this mule, or a manual option for traditionalists. Mahindra promises Level 2 ADAS with semi-auto parking, 5G connectivity, and four drive modes: Normal, Grass-Gravel-Snow, Mud-Ruts, and Sand.
Market Impact
A 2026 debut seems on the cards, possibly mid-year, aligning with the Scorpio-N facelift rollout. Priced competitively against rivals, it could capture buyers craving SUV flair in a pickup body.
